Mrs. Ann Hendricks, a Lane oonnty pioneer, died at her home at Hendrlck's Fony, 15 miles east of Eugene, Fri day, aged 71. Mrs. Hendrioka crossed the plains in the eailv '40 with ber (athor's (.tuiilv. They were attaoked by Imliaiia on Pitt river and Mrs Hen. driiks was shot with an airow through her arm, rea l iring her u cripple for ever afterwarns.
